Description
Under general supervision, performs varied clerical and recordkeeping work; provides information to the public; acts as a receptionist; does general typing; operates City's switchboard; does related work as required.
Examples of Duties
Representative Duties Maintains the reception desk; types routine letters, documents and reports from rough drafts, marginal notes or oral and written instructions; types statistical data; receives, distributes and dispatches mail; checks columns of figures and names; maintains mailing lists; checks and alphabetizes records; arranges material for typing; reads proofs; enters information on cards and forms; assists or substitutes for superiors in handling more responsible office work; answers telephone calls and makes necessary connections; places local and long-distance calls; keeps records of calls and toll charges; operates various office equipment.
Organizational Responsibilities This is an entry level Class in the typing and clerical series. Applicants for positions in this Class are not expected to have clerical experience; rather, a high degree of clerical aptitude and basic typing skills are considered necessary for an employee working in this class. Employees in this Class are normally assigned to offices where supervision and training are received from a more senior clerical or secretarial employee.
Typical Qualifications
Education and Experience Graduation from high school or GED equivalent, including or supplemented by courses in typing and office procedures. Experience in public contact and switchboard duties is highly desirable.
Knowledge and Abilities Must have knowledge of modern office methods, procedures and equipment and general knowledge of arithmetic and proper English; must be able to speak clearly and distinctly with good voice modulation; ability to meet the public with tact and courtesy; to learn what services are performed by each department and the location of employees within the City; to spell correctly and use proper English; to perform a variety of clerical work; to make comparisons and computations quickly and accurately; to have skill in indexing and filing; to work cooperatively with others; to have a high degree of clerical aptitude and a liking for office work.
Skills Must be able to type at a rate of 40 words per minute and have the ability to use a switchboard, calculator, personal computer and word processor. Must have computer skills in Word. Skill in Outlook and Excel or Spreadsheet is highly desirable. Bilingual ability is highly desirable (Gardena is a multi-ethnic community with a variety of languages.)

Physical Demands and Working Conditions Work is performed in a busy office environment with frequent interruptions. Office work requires using a computer keyboard and screen and heavy volume of phone work. Physical demands include sitting for long periods of time, standing, kneeling, bending, twisting, reaching and grasping in the performance of duties.
License Must have and maintain a valid Class C California Driver's License.
